20 years ago we accomplished our dream to represent Mexico and Metal at the Band Explosion 88 World Final.

Band Explosion 88 World Final Tokyo Japan

* SALVADOR AGUILAR on vocals that then formed the famous Mexican band CODA

* HECTOR CASTAÑON the guitar master that formed most of the best Mexican guitars players and recorded "El Hemisario" album with Huizar (Luzbel)

* ALEXIS LANGAGNE on drums was studying a Phd in physics while playing at Valquiria. Also recorded "El Hemisario" album with Huizar (Luzbel)

*CARLOS SALOMON on keyboards, also played on "El Hemisario Album" was then an entrepreneur developing the first guitar methods of the best Mexican guitar Players

*MAURICIO QUIROGA-PASCAL on bass was the founder of the famous Mexican band Makina, then moved to Chile and played at Game Over (Alfredo Alonso, Sotein, Marcelo Naves), Kraal (Alvaro Soms (dorso), Juan Eduardo Rodriguez (Protocosmic), Founded The Shrink and played in Protocosmic.

In honor for the next generation of musicians who will follow our path!
